The Life Insurance Association (LIA) won Excellence in Education by a Professional Body at the Education Awards 2025 last year, celebrated for its commitment to enabling the highest standards in financial advisory practice across Ireland.
The LIA, as the recognised centre of excellence for the education and development of finance professionals, continually innovates its membership and qualifications offering. Its programmes are designed to enhance knowledge, professional skills, and compliance with evolving industry standards, supporting career progression at every stage.
Judges praised LIA for its forward-thinking approach to professional education, highlighting the organisation’s ability to combine innovative learning programmes with measurable impact on the life insurance sector and the career progression of its members.
“The Life Insurance Association demonstrates outstanding leadership in developing the knowledge, skills, and qualifications of finance professionals. Its dedication to high-quality, practical learning ensures members are equipped to meet evolving industry standards and deliver excellence in practice,” the judges said.
